FIZ Karlsruhe is teaming up with Thomson Reuters Scientific to provide a
series of workshops on the Derwent World Patent Index (DWPI) on STN,
DWPI Chemistry Resource (DCR) on STN, and GENESEQ on STN (DGENE)
databases. All of the workshops feature extensive hands-on practice time
and are free-of-charge. Registration is required via the link given
below.

A description of each workshop is shown below.

 

Introduction to the Derwent World Patents Index (DWPI) on STN

 

* What is DWPI on STN?

* A tour through a typical database record

* Understanding DWPI patent families

* Review of relevant STN search, analysis and display commands

* Practical tips for DWPI text, classification and bibliographic
searching

* Extending searches to related databases - INPAFAMDB, WPIFV and
LITALERT

 

DWPI Chemistry Resource (DCR) and supporting databases

 

* What is the DWPI Chemistry Resource (DCR)?

* A tour through a typical DCR database record

* Effective use of name, formula and other text search fields

* Chemical structure searching in the DWPI Chemistry Resource

* Navigating between DCR and DWPI patent family records

* Refining DWPI Chemistry Resource retrieval using ROLES

* Refining answer sets with DWPI Classification (DC), Manual Codes and
IPCs

* Tips for multi-file searching DWPI/DCR with other key STN databases

* An introduction to Fragmentation Code generation using STN Express

 

GENESEQ on STN (DGENE) and Supporting Databases

 

* Overview of the DGENE database

* A tour through a typical DGENE record

* Comprehensive searching using USGENE(r) and DGENE

* The basics of conducting a BLAST sequence search

* Getting the best out of BLAST advanced options

* Post-processing BLAST search results using STN Express 8.x

* FASTA-based GETSIM similarity searching

* Small fragment sequence searching using GETSEQ
